Study in Canada - University of Calgary SbM Lab Graduate Scholarships 2026-27
If you are an engineer or materials scientist driven to pioneer sustainable, intelligent, and climate-resilient infrastructure, an exceptional opportunity awaits you in Canada.
The Smart Building Materials (SbM) Lab at the University of Calgary, supervised by Dr. Barney H. H., is recruiting motivated graduate researchers for fully funded MSc and PhD positions starting in Fall 2027.
Positioned at the dynamic intersection of material science, digital infrastructure, and sustainable civil engineering, this research group focuses on next-generation building materials, embedded sensing, and computational design. The Research Focus: What Will You Work On?
The SbM Lab tackles critical challenges facing modern urban infrastructure. As an MSc or PhD researcher, your work will combine experimental materials development with computational modeling.
Core areas of research include:
- Developing low-carbon, highly durable, and cementitious materials.
- Integrating embedded sensors and non-destructive testing into civil infrastructure.
- Leveraging machine learning, large language models (LLMs), and data-driven methods for materials design.
- Conducting rigorous life-cycle assessments (LCA) to validate environmental performance.
Eligibility Criteria
To be considered for graduate research positions within the SbM Lab for the Fall 2027 intake, applicants must meet the following baseline requirements:
-
Academic Background:
- For PhD Candidates: Must hold a Bachelor’s degree (BSc) and a relevant Master’s degree (MSc) in Civil Engineering, Environmental Engineering, Materials Science, Chemical Engineering, or a closely aligned discipline.
- For MSc Candidates: Must hold a recognized Bachelor’s degree in a relevant engineering or physical science discipline with strong academic standing.
-
Minimum Academic Benchmarks (GPA):
- MSc Applicants: Minimum cumulative GPA of 3.5 / 4.0 (or equivalent).
- PhD Applicants: Minimum cumulative GPA of 3.0 / 4.0 (or equivalent).
- Computational Foundations: Demonstrated proficiency in Python and standard numerical/analytical data analysis workflows.
- Research Foundations: Demonstrated prior laboratory, thesis, or technical research experience.
Preferred Qualifications (What Sets You Apart)
Because competition is fierce for 1–2 funded seats, strong preference will be given to candidates with experience in one or more of the following:
- Microstructural Characterization: Hands-on experience with techniques such as Scanning Electron Microscopy (SEM), micro-Computed Tomography (\mu-CT), and Fourier Transform Infrared Spectroscopy (FTIR).
- Sample Fabrication: Direct experience casting and testing concrete, mortar, or novel cementitious composites.
- Instrumentation: Experience designing, deploying, or testing embedded physical sensors.
- Data & Machine Learning: Applied experience in machine learning algorithms, deep learning, or large language models for scientific applications.
- Environmental Assessment: Experience performing Life-Cycle Assessments (LCA) on industrial or construction systems.
- Scholarly Output: Peer-reviewed journal publications or conference papers (particularly vital for PhD applicants).
Required Application Documents
Before reaching out, prepare the following three items in clean PDF format:
- Cover Letter / Statement of Motivation: A concise letter explaining your research interests, how your background aligns with the SbM Lab’s research agenda, and why you wish to pursue your graduate studies at the University of Calgary.
- Curriculum Vitae (CV): An up-to-date academic resume highlighting your educational timeline, GPA, technical programming skills, lab proficiencies, and publications (if applicable).
- Reference Information: Full names, institutional affiliations, and direct contact details (email and phone number) for at least two academic or professional referees.
Step-by-Step Application Guide
Securing a funded graduate research seat in Canada starts with an initial inquiry to the lab supervisor before proceeding to formal university admission:
Step 1: Prepare Your Application Dossier
Assemble your targeted cover letter, detailed CV, and contact details for your two referees into a single clean PDF dossier (or separate well-labeled PDFs).
Step 2: Format the Email Subject Line
The lab uses a specific subject-line filter. You must set your subject line strictly as:
Prospective Student – [Degree] – Your Name – Term
(For example: Prospective Student – PhD – Alex Chen – Fall 2027)
Step 3: Send Your Application Email
Email your complete package directly to the lab at:
smartmblab@gmail.com
Step 4: Formal University Admission
Candidates shortlisted by Dr. Barney H. H. will be invited to complete the formal graduate school admission application through the University of Calgary’s official Faculty of Graduate Studies portal.
